Uploaded image for project: 'ui-inventory'
  1. ui-inventory
  2. UIIN-1212

Fast add settings: Default suppress from discovery value

    XMLWordPrintable

Details

    • Story
    • Status: Closed (View Workflow)
    • P4
    • Resolution: Duplicate
    • None
    • None
    • None
    • Prokopovych

    Description

      Purpose: Some institutions will want their fast add records to be suppressed from discovery by default while others will not. The purpose of this story is to allow institutions to set their preferred default at a tenant level.

      User story statement(s):

      As a member of the circ staff
      I want my fast add records to be automatically set with the correct value for "suppressed from discover"
      so I don't make mistakes and set it incorrectly

      Options:

      1. Settings page - This is the ideal option but will require backend work. Mockup: https://drive.google.com/file/d/1K0qpuznqQkckxtNmzWcCorTY-8s6Hsh0/view?usp=sharing
      2. Tenant config - Team says this could also be done in tenant config, which would not require backend work

      Scenarios (assuming option 1 is selected):

      1. Scenario:
        • Given Inventory settings
        • When displayed
        • Then the Instance, Holdings and Items section should display a "Fast add" option
      2. Scenario:
        • Given Settings > Inventory > Fast add
        • When displayed
        • Then:
          • Page header: Fast add
          • Controls:
            • Cancel - Close without saving
            • Save & close
            • X - Same as cancel
            • Save and Cancel only become active when form is "dirty" (has unsaved changes)
      3. Scenario:
        • Given Settings > Inventory > Fast add
        • When displayed
        • Then "Default suppress from discovery" should display:
          • Dropdown menu
          • Values = Yes, No
          • Default = Yes
          • Note (and this is out-of-scope for this issue), the default here will impact the "Suppress from discovery" value in the Instance record
      4. Scenario:
        • Given Settings > Inventory > Fast add form is dirty
        • When I try to navigate away before saving changes
        • Then the standard unsaved changes popup should display

      TestRail: Results

        Attachments

          Issue Links

            Activity

              People

                Unassigned Unassigned
                cboerema Cate Boerema
                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                  Created:
                  Updated:
                  Resolved:

                  TestRail: Runs

                    TestRail: Cases